DVD's no longer play on my ASUS laptop. I load the DVD into the disc port and it begins to load. Once it loads Windows Media Player flashes on the screen for a fraction of a second and then disappears before the movie has loaded. Any quick simple fixes for this? I am not an expert with computrs. Need something simple!
 
Solution
Check for a well rooted malware infection and rootkits:
http://live.vipreantivirus.com/

If the system comes up clean then make a new user account and see if Windows Media Player has the same problem under 'Test User 2' (for example).

Chances are that it's either (1) malware/rootkit infection, or (2) a corrupted local user profile...

Can you read the files off the disc, or just not play them? what do you use for a media player? Get VLC and try again, if that does not work how old is the player?
